2-NITRONAPHTHO(2,1-B)FURAN-1-ACETICACID

Base Information Edit
  • Chemical Name:2-NITRONAPHTHO(2,1-B)FURAN-1-ACETICACID
  • CAS No.:92262-74-3
  • Molecular Formula:C14H9NO5
  • Molecular Weight:271.229
  • Hs Code.:2932999099
  • Mol file:92262-74-3.mol
2-NITRONAPHTHO(2,1-B)FURAN-1-ACETICACID

Synonyms:R 7449

Chemical Property of 2-NITRONAPHTHO(2,1-B)FURAN-1-ACETICACID Edit
Chemical Property:
  • Vapor Pressure:5.45E-11mmHg at 25°C 
  • Boiling Point:504.3°Cat760mmHg 
  • Flash Point:258.8°C 
  • PSA:96.26000 
  • Density:1.508g/cm3 
  • LogP:3.64450
